**Alert: PriceLab experiment variance breach**

Fires when a ticket-pricing experiment on the Gatewing platform produces prices outside configured guardrails. Affected experiments are paused automatically; plugins receive a `pricing.halted` event and must fall back to base prices. Do not retry halted experiments programmatically. Plugins ignoring the halt event will be rate-limited. Guardrail definitions, event payload schema, and reinstatement steps are documented on the page below.

dashboard of kajep-tajog = https://harbor.tolvaqworks.example/pipeline/run/dash/pipeline/228e278bbf9b3bc2

## Canary Environments — LedgerPine Gateway

Canary deploys in the Ostvale cluster gate on three signals: error-rate delta under 0.5%, p95 latency within 10% of baseline, and zero failed health probes over a ten-minute window. Reviewers should confirm any change to these thresholds is mirrored in both the canary and baseline manifests before approval. For reference, the gating configuration currently applied to the canary tier is shown below.

service settings:
PRAIX_LOG_LEVEL=error
PRAIX_METRICS_HOST=metrics.praix.qorvelcorp.corp
PRAIX_POOL_SIZE=16

Status: two bidders remain, Ardensea Group and a private consortium. Indicative offers within 8% of book value. Diligence data room open; HR consultation plan drafted; pension transfer terms outstanding. Key risks: customer contract novation and retention of the Garsdale plant team. Decision required at next month's review: proceed to exclusivity or retain and restructure. Heads of department must not brief teams before sign-off. The confidential board position follows immediately below.

management briefing: Jorixax Holdings is in early talks to buy Casixax Holdings for about $420.3 million. The Fenmir launch date is October 27, and nothing goes to the press before then. Legal wants the Keloxek Foods term sheet redrafted before April 16.